济州解淀粉芽胞杆菌,从养猪场废物中分离得到的新物种。

Lysinibacillus jejuensis sp. nov., isolated from swinery waste.

机构信息

Department of Biology, College of Natural Science, Jeju National University, Jeju, 690-756, Republic of Korea.

出版信息

J Microbiol. 2013 Dec;51(6):872-6. doi: 10.1007/s12275-013-2500-7. Epub 2013 Dec 19.

DOI:10.1007/s12275-013-2500-7
PMID:24385367
Abstract

A Gram-positive, endospore-forming, rod-shaped bacterium, designated strain N2-5(T), was isolated from swinery waste collected in Jeju, Republic of Korea. A phylogenetic analysis based on 16S rRNA gene sequences demonstrated that strain N2-5(T) formed a phyletic group within the phylum Firmicutes with less than 97.0% similarities to members of the genus Lysinibacillus, its nearest phylogenetic neighbors. The highest levels of sequence similarity to the isolate were observed against Lysinibacillus xylanilyticus XDB9(T) (96.8%), Lysinibacillus macroides LMG 18474(T) (95.6%), and Lysinibacillus parviboronicapiens BAM-582(T) (95.6%). The organism grew optimally at 30°C and pH 7 and in the presence of 1-3% (w/v) NaCl. Strain N2-5(T) was chemotaxonomically characterized by possessing menaquinone-7 (MK-7) as the major menaquinone, and iso-C15:0 (54.9%), iso-C17:1 ω10c (12.0%), and C16:1 ω7c alcohol (11.8%) as the predominant fatty acids. The genomic DNA G+C content of the novel strain was 43.3 mol% and the cell-wall peptidoglycan was type A4α. The major polar lipids were diphosphatidylglycerol, phosphatidylglycerol, and phosphatidylethanolamine. Based on its phenotypic properties and phylogenetic data, strain N2-5(T) (=DSM 28310(T) =KCTC13837(T)) represents a novel species in the genus Lysinibacillus, for which the name Lysinibacillus jejuensis sp. nov. is proposed.

摘要

一株革兰氏阳性、产芽孢的杆状细菌,被命名为 N2-5(T) 菌株,从韩国济州岛收集的养猪场废物中分离得到。基于 16S rRNA 基因序列的系统发育分析表明,N2-5(T) 菌株在厚壁菌门内形成一个分支,与赖氨酸芽孢杆菌属的成员相似度低于 97.0%,是其最接近的系统发育近邻。与该分离株的序列相似性最高的是木聚糖赖氨酸芽孢杆菌 XDB9(T)(96.8%)、巨大芽孢杆菌 LMG 18474(T)(95.6%)和小硼酸赖氨酸芽孢杆菌 BAM-582(T)(95.6%)。该菌最适生长温度为 30°C,pH 值为 7,在 1-3%(w/v)NaCl 存在下生长。N2-5(T) 菌株的化学分类特征为主要的类异戊二烯醌为menaquinone-7 (MK-7),主要脂肪酸为 iso-C15:0 (54.9%)、iso-C17:1 ω10c (12.0%)和 C16:1 ω7c 醇 (11.8%)。新菌株的基因组 DNA G+C 含量为 43.3 mol%,细胞壁肽聚糖为 A4α 型。主要的极性脂为双磷脂酰甘油、磷脂酰甘油和磷脂酰乙醇胺。根据其表型特性和系统发育数据,N2-5(T) 菌株(=DSM 28310(T)=KCTC13837(T))代表赖氨酸芽孢杆菌属中的一个新种,现提议将其命名为济州岛赖氨酸芽孢杆菌(Lysinibacillus jejuensis)sp. nov.。
